Explore the intersection of algebraic graph theory and quantum computing in this 47-minute lecture delivered by Chris Godsil from the University of Waterloo. Delve into advanced mathematical concepts and their applications in quantum information science. Gain insights into how graph theory techniques can be leveraged to solve problems in quantum computing and understand the fundamental connections between these two fields. Enhance your understanding of both theoretical aspects and practical implications in this cutting-edge area of research presented at the Fields Institute on January 10, 2024.
